We’ve put the palate to the test in Drinking Problems, a video series in which our tasters, ranging from a James Beard Award-winning chef to a comedian who simply appreciates a good drink, give us the good, the bad, and the ugly of what they’re drinking.

In this episode, three tasting teams have signed on to sample four different beers and give us their tasting notes.

Once again, Sergio and Country Velador of Super Chunk Sweets and Treats in Scottsdale, Joshua Hebert of Posh Improvisational Cuisine in Scottsdale and Christopher Gross of Christopher’s Restaurant and Crush Lounge in Phoenix, and Marisol Chavez and Sara Palmer of For A Good Time Call Improv Troupe have lent their palates to this experiment.

This time the pairs try Pabst Blue Ribbon from Pabst Brewing Co., Watermelon Ale from Phoenix Ale Brewery, Hazelnut Brown Nectar from Rogue Ales & Spirits, and Kiltlifter from Four Peaks Brewing Company.
